View LMNTElectrolyte Powder vs Sports Drinks: Quick Comparison
| Feature | Electrolyte Powders | Sports Drinks |
|---|---|---|
| Best for | Daily hydration | Workouts and convenience |
| Sugar | Usually low or zero | Often higher, varies by brand |
| Convenience | Needs mixing | Ready to drink |
| Control | More control over formula and strength | Fixed formula |
| Best use | Everyday hydration routines | Exercise, sports, and grab-and-go hydration |
Electrolyte Powders vs Sports Drinks: Which Is Healthier?
For everyday use, electrolyte powders usually make more sense because many are lower in sugar and easier to fit into a daily hydration routine. Sports drinks can still be useful during workouts, but they are not always the best choice if you want a cleaner option for daily sipping.
Choose Electrolyte Powders if you want:
- Better daily hydration
- Lower sugar or zero sugar options
- Cleaner ingredient profiles
- More control over sodium and formula strength
- Options for Energy, Immunity, or high sodium support
Choose Sports Drinks if you want:
- Grab-and-go convenience
- Hydration during workouts
- No mixing required
- A traditional sports drink experience
- Something easy to find in stores
Why Electrolyte Powders Usually Win for Daily Hydration
Electrolyte powders tend to be the better everyday option because they are often lower in sugar, easier to customize, and available in formulas designed for routine use. If your goal is daily hydration, a powder or stick format gives you more flexibility than a bottled sports drink.
Why Sports Drinks Still Make Sense for Workouts
Sports drinks are useful when convenience matters most. They are ready to drink, familiar, and easy to grab before, during, or after activity. For intense workouts or sports, that convenience can matter.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are electrolyte powders better than sports drinks?
Electrolyte powders are usually better for daily hydration because they are often lower in sugar and easier to customize. Sports drinks are better for convenience and workouts.
Are sports drinks only for workouts?
No, but they usually make the most sense around workouts, travel, or times when you want quick hydration without mixing a powder.
Do electrolyte powders have less sugar than sports drinks?
Usually, yes. Many electrolyte powders are low sugar or zero sugar, while sports drinks vary more depending on the brand.
What is better for daily hydration?
Electrolyte powders are usually better for daily hydration because they fit more easily into a regular routine without feeling like a sugary sports drink.
